An orange-golden iridescent culture, designated A1X5R2, was isolated from a compost soil suspension which was amended with NCTC 2665 culture supernatant. The cells were non-motile, Gram-stain-negative, 0.4-0.5 µm wide and 0.7-1.4 µm long. The 16S rRNA-based phylogenetic and whole-genome analyses revealed that strain A1X5R2 forms a distinct lineage within the family and is closely related to members of the genus (, 93.04 % similarity, and , 92.77 %). The organism grew at 22-47 °C (optimal at 37 °C), salinity <3 % (optimal at 1.5 %) and at pH 7. The major respiratory quinone was ubiquinone-10, but a small quantity of ubiquinone-9 was also detected The major polyamine was homospermidine, but a small quantity of putrescine was also detected. The strain contained Cω7, C, C ω7 and C as the major fatty acids. The main polar lipids were phosphatidylethanolamine, phosphatidylglycerol, phosphatidylcholine, phosphatidylinositol, sphingoglycolipid, diphosphatidylglycerol, two unidentified phospholipids and three unidentified amino lipids. The DNA G+C content was 64.9 mol%. According to the results of phylogenetic and phylogenomic analyses, as well as its physiological characteristics, strain A2X5R2 represents the type species of a novel genus within the family . The name gen. nov., sp. nov. is proposed, with the type strain being A1X5R2 (=NCCB 100839=DSM 112829).
